| Feature | MCM Flexible Stone | MCM Big Slab Board | MCM 3D Printing Series |
|---|---|---|---|
| Best For | Curved walls, uneven surfaces, accent pieces | Modern, minimalist spaces, large open walls | Custom designs, artistic focal points |
| Weight | Ultra-lightweight (3-5kg/m²) | Lightweight (8-10kg/m²) | Lightweight (5-7kg/m²) |
| Durability | Scratch-resistant, moisture-proof | High strength, impact-resistant | Wear-resistant, fade-proof |
| Installation Ease | Peel-and-stick or dry installation | Prefabricated, quick mounting | Custom-fit, precision installation |
